Matt Rawle is a British actor. He was born in Birmingham on 10 March 1974.[1] He has appeared in many high-profile theatre productions which include Martin Guerre, Evita and Zorro.[citation needed] His performances in the theatre have seen him nominated for numerous awards including WOS, Olivier awards and best haircut for an over 35.

Theatre Work[2]

Show Production Role Awards / Nominations
Martin Guerre Original London Production (1996) Martin Guerre
Into the Woods Donmar Warehouse Revival (1998) Rapunzel's Prince
Hard Times Original London Production (2000) Master Sammy Sleary
Almost Like Being In Love Original London Production (2001) Performer
Putting It Together Chichester Festival Production (2001) The Younger Man
Camelot Open Air Theatre Revival (2004) Lancelot
Assassins Sheffield Theatres Production (2006) Balladeer
Evita London Revival (2006) Ché Nominated for WhatsOnStage Award
Aspects of Love UK Tour (2007) Alex Dillingham
Zorro London Revival (2008) Don Diego de la Vega / Zorro Nominated for Laurence Olivier Award for Best Actor in a Musical, Nominated for WhatsOnStage Award
The Light in the Piazza UK Premiere (2009) Fabrizio Naccarelli
Pippin Menier Chocolate Factory Revival (2011) Leading Player
Cabaret UK Tour (2012) Clifford Bradshaw
Cabaret London Revival (2012) Clifford Bradshaw
Anything Goes UK Tour (2015) Billy Crocker
